# Break-Glass: Catalog Cache Invalidation

Scope: the Pinrow product catalog at Veldstone Retail. If stale prices persist after a purge and the Hollowmere invalidation queue is wedged, use break-glass to flush the edge tier directly. Contractors: get verbal sign-off from the catalog lead first. Steps: open the Hollowmere admin shell, select emergency-flush, confirm the tenant, and run it once — repeated flushes thrash the origin. Access is logged and expires after 20 minutes. Unseal the admin shell with the passphrase below.

recovery phrase for kahop-tajog: istix-casvan

Team — read-replica lag alarm fired on Bramblehost's reporting cluster at 14:02, cleared by 14:19. Cause was a long analytics query, not replication failure. No auth or audit data was stale beyond the window. Flagging for security review since session reads briefly hit the lagged replica. Relevant trace token follows below.

build token for kagaf-hahof: htk14_9d3d4d26d7d8de

# MeterLane Environments

MeterLane enforces per-tenant rate quotas differently across environments. In dev, quotas are effectively unlimited to keep integration tests simple. Staging applies production-shaped quotas at one-tenth scale so throttling paths are exercised. Production quotas are tiered by plan and evaluated per tenant per minute, with burst allowances reconciled hourly. When reviewing quota-related changes, compare against the live production values, which are currently:

deployment values, kajep-kageg:
[praix]
host = praix.paliqcorp.corp
user = praix_svc
database = praix_prod